Another COW WOW !!!!
Sorry bout the Title but I coudn't resist.
The story is,,,,, I had an offer from someone to buy my car but they didn't want the mail order tune I had in it. I could have gone back to stock OEM tune since I had the stock file and the LS2 edit program allowed me to do that but the hassle and expense of trying to get the cable assigned to another buyer/car (and other issues), caused me and the potential buyer to back out of the deal. So at this point, I decided to try another tuner. Not that the first tune didn't tune the car well, I am sure it did, but Chuck from Corvettes Of Westchester (COW) will also tune the A4 tranny in the 05.
To borrow from a certain current marketing campaign,
"THE WOW STARTS HERE"
Let me tell you, the tranny is now where I felt it should have been from the factory. It shifts faster than it ever has before. Now when I hit the go pedal, I don't have to wait for the tranny to downshift. It goes and there is no doubt about it. Before it was sloppy, felt like I had to wait a second before the TCM decided it was okay to down shift and I'm sorry, when I want to downshift, I want it NOW, not when the TCM thinks it's okay. The shifts are crisp and to the point. When I drive it easy there isn't a great deal of difference from stock but you can tell the tranny is shifting quicker, IE there is a more noticeable shift, not the SLIDE into gear but crisp and to the point. When you downshift for power it will knock you head back into the headrest.
I LIKE IT!!!
As to the motor, well this thing is a beast from the factory and it still is. Butt dyno says there MAY be a little more than with the other mail order tune but that is awfully hard to judge.
I am not one to cheer lead usually but I have to tell you, I would, and will, unequivocally recommend Chucks mail order tune above any other mail order tune I have heard about or used. He delivers what he promises, it isn't just a sales pitch.
